I'm thinking of replacing the brake lines on my SV650 S K4 in the next month or so. It seems that a two-line setup is the better -- and cheaper -- option to go for.
My question is: what do I replace the splitter with on the RHS/offside fork leg? Looking at it, it seems that it should be possible to fit the same clip as you find on the LHS/nearside leg. What have other people done? Do I just need to start a new thread in the Wanted section asking for nearside clip from a pointy?

Thanks for that, guys.
The Ebay link really helped, TJ. I had seen p-clips on the HEL website, http://helperformance.com/catalogue/ancillaries/, but wasn't sure what they were, exactly. The picture on Ebay made it much clearer. Looks like I'll need two smaller clips, one for each fork leg, plus a larger one for the bottom triple clamp which will have both lines passing through it.

For my 2 line set, I just needed one for the RH leg. I re-used all the others. (LH leg and yoke)
